Fordham Law Student successfully nominates human rights lawyer for CNN Heroes Award
CNN has been airing a “Heroes” award program since May of 2007. They have a system where viewers could submit a nomination for six different awards. Fordham Law student Kush Shukla nominated Pablo Fajardo in the “Fighting for Justice” category. Kush had worked with Pablo as a Leitner Intern in Ecuador in the summer of 2006.
Based on Kush's nomination, Pablo Fajardo was selected as one of three finalists in the “Fighting for Justice” category. CNN then flew out to Ecuador to film to interview Pablo. CNN's “Blue Ribbon Panel,” which consisted of celebrities, humanitarians, and world leaders, then selected one finalist from each category.

The Panel included Deepak Chopra, Lance Armstrong, Deekembe Mutombo, Mohammad Yunuus and many others. This panel selected Pablo Fajardo to receive the CNN Heroes award! He was presented the award live in NYC at the American Museum for Natural History on December 6th. This program was broadcast worldwide on all of CNN's channels and affiliates.
